Job description

Job Title : Bank Nursery Practitioner

Location : 175 Hampton Road Twickenham TW2 5NG

Salary : Up to 14 per hour

Hours : Zero-hour contract

Reports to : Room Leader / Nursery Manager

What Youll Be Doing
  • Be All In : You bring strongcommitmentto delivering high-quality care and education supporting childrens development and wellbeing with consistency and professionalism.
  • Come Together : You collaborateby building trusted relationships with families colleagues and leadership contributing to a shared vision of excellence.
  • Be Yourself : You applyself-awarenessin your daily practice reflecting on your impact embracing growth and recognising the individuality of every child and team member.
  • Go Further : You demonstrateambitionby leading practice mentoring others and using your knowledge and initiative to drive continuous improvement across the setting.
Benefits & Perks
  • Financial Rewards : Salaries that match or exceed industry standards reviewed annually. Includes performance-related bonuses and a 500 referral bonus.
  • Incredible Incentives : Regular events like our annual Christmas Party and Summer BBQ plus daily lunches with a variety of options; completely free!
  • Career Growth Opportunities : Targeted talent mapping professional development programmes and 1-to-1 coaching to help you Go Furtherin your role.
  • Loyalty Rewards : Yearly increases in annual leave and recognition for your commitment through the Fennies Club gift cards and commemorative plaques celebrating your length of service and our Be All Inspirit.
  • Well-being Focus : Access to our BUPA Employee Assistance Programme for 24/7 mental health and wellbeing support up to 33 days of annual leave and childcare discounts available depending on your role.
What You Bring
  • Passion for Early Years Education : A genuine love for working with children and a commitment to providing the best start in life.
  • Knowledge of EYFS : A solid understanding of child development the Birth to 5 Matters framework and the EYFS curriculum.
  • Qualified & Experienced : A Level 2 / 3 qualification in Childcare and a minimum grade C / 4 in GCSE Maths and English (or equivalent).
  • Build Strong Relationships : Form bonds with children and their families ensuring each child feels secure and supported.
  • Team Player : Excellent communication skills the ability to give and receive feedback and a positive proactive approach.
